Kota Kinabalu: Sabahans are more concerned about actions to be taken to quickly resolve the long-standing water problem and restore the supply immediately.
Kota Kinabalu Chinese Chamber of Commerce and Industry (KKCCCI) President Datuk Michael Lui said the people are not really interested about the root cause of the problem, be it water or electricity supply.

He said the water and electricity problem in Sabah is a serious livelihood problem for all as they are basic livelihood needs.
It is absolutely unfair that shortage of both year after year has extremely affected the people enough to cause resentment and dissatisfaction.
Hence, he said, the decision by Chief Minister Datuk Seri Hajiji Haji Noor to set up a task force to monitor both is appropriate.
“KKCCCI hopes the Task Force will have absolute power to seek solutions,” Michael said in a statement.

He believes the Task Force should focus on how to solve the root causes and the implementation of water and electricity supply infrastructure development projects should be the top priority.
“We really need more funds in this area to improve and strengthen the electricity and water supply infrastructure.”
